Abstract
Recording performance of laminated antiferromagnetically coupled (LAC) media with two and three magnetic layers was investigated using a spinstand. Comparison was made with the recording performance of conventional single layered (SL) media. Thermal stability of LAC media was found to be higher than that of SL media. Overwrite degradation was observed when the total thickness of the laminated structure increased beyond certain limits.
